About Zip Code 78255

78255 is a zip code in the San Antonio Metropolitan area. It has a population of 18,149 and a population density of 825, which is 89% above the national average. It has a median age of 40, which is 5 years above the San Antonio Metro median age and 1 year above the national average.


Zip code 78255 has a median home value of $552,650, which is 47% above the Metro average.The average rent of $1,433 is 3% below the metro average rent and 31% below the national average rent The average household income in zip code 78255 is $149,188 , which is 53% above the Metro average household income and 50% above the national average of household income.

Zip code 78255's population is made up of 63% married, 27% single, 6% divorced and 4% widowed. Baby Boomers make up the largest percentage of the population at 37%, while Gen Z have the second largest segment at 27%. Homeowners make up 84% of the population in zip code 78255.

Cross Mountain crime index is 136 which is higher than the national average.

136
Crime Index
100
National Crime Index

Crime Index represents the risk of crime occurring in a area and is measured against national index of 100. If the Crime Index of an area is above 100 the crime in that area is relatively higher when compared to US. If the Crime Index of an area is below 100 the crime in that area is lower when compared to US.
